About this Modpack
Realmax Essentials is a Minecraft modpack I built to give players the smoothest and most fun gameplay. It is mainly made for PVP and SMP servers, so you get faster reactions, better visuals, and a clear interface while fighting or surviving with friends. The pack comes with FPS boost features, which reduce lag and make the game run better even on mid-end PCs. I also added visual improvements like clean textures, sharp outlines, and bright colors so everything looks clear without losing Minecraft’s original style. Realmax Essentials is lightweight, simple to use, and designed to help you focus on skills, teamwork, and smooth performance in every match or survival world.at last it includes my private texture pack.⚠️If you are using another client rather than feather client,uninstall the feather mod or the modpack won't work.⚠️

Frequently Asked Questions
Realmax Essentials server crashes or won't start – what to do?
Most common causes: insufficient RAM or wrong fabric loader. Check latest.log for "OutOfMemoryError" → increase RAM to at least 6 GB. For "Mixin" or "ClassNotFoundException" errors: modpack version and loader don't match. Realmax Essentials server lagging – performance tips
1) Increase RAM to 6 GB+. 2) Reduce server view-distance to 8 (server.properties). 3) Pre-generate chunks with the "Chunky" plugin. 4) Use /spark profiler to check which mods consume the most tick time.
